Population of snow leopards in Qinghai reaches 1,200, signaling key progress in endangered species protection

Population of snow leopards in Qinghai reaches 1,200, signaling key progress in endangered species protection

Population of snow leopards in Qinghai reaches 1,200, signaling key progress in endangered species protection

Population of snow leopards in Qinghai reaches 1,200, signaling key progress in endangered species protection

Population of snow leopards in Qinghai reaches 1,200, signaling key progress in endangered species protection
Population of snow leopards in Qinghai reaches 1,200, signaling key progress in endangered species protection
Ads Links by Easy Branches
Play online games for free at games.easybranches.com
Guest Post Services www.easybranches.com/contribute